POI : Volcanism Type : Lava Spouts Name : Silicate Magma Lava Spouts First discovered for ExTool : Grippy gecko | Lava spouts are weakened areas of a planet's surface where molten material percolates, generating heat and emitting vapour and gases. The nature of the material varies accordingg to the planet's composition and circumstances. A surface eruption of molten material, found on terrestrial planets with silicate magma. |
